hostelry

/ˈhɑstəlri/
noun
  1. An establishment that provides lodging and often food and drink for travelers; an inn or hotel.
    • They stopped at a cozy hostelry for the night after a long day of hiking.
    • The village hostelry served hearty meals and had clean, simple rooms.
    • The old hostelry by the river has been welcoming guests for over two centuries.
